    The Moneymaker Tomato is a terrific, high yielding heirloom that produces delicious, bright red and smooth fruits that are perfect for fresh eating. This variety's vine can grow to 5-6' and produce very heavy yields of 4-6 ounce fruits. This tasty heirloom tomato does well in hot humid climates and greenhouse growing. The Moneymaker originates from England and produces vigorous vines that should be staked for best results.

    The Bradley Tomato is one of the all time Southern favorites! This tomato variety is a reliable, productive plant that has fairly good cover, producing attractive, smooth pink fruit with a tasty mild flavor. Bradley is a disease resistant variety released in 1961 by Dr. Joe McFerran of the University of Arkansas. The seeds produce delicious, sweet tomatoes that are well balanced with just enough acidity to give you that old-fashioned big tomato flavor that you love so much.

    Zenzei Hybrid Roma Tomato Seeds produce a 2023 All-America Selections winner prized for its early maturity and exceptional productivity. Developed with Midwest growing conditions in mind, this dependable Roma-type tomato performs well even in less-than-ideal weather. The plants yield abundant, uniformly shaped plum tomatoes with dense, high-quality flesh and fewer problems such as spotting or blossom end rot, making Zenzei an excellent choice for sauces, canning, and other preserving needs.

    Little Sicily tomato seeds produce a distinctive Italian-style variety inspired by traditional tomatoes grown in southern Italy. This compact determinate, paste-type tomato sets clusters of small, elongated fruits, typically 1–2 inches long, with thick walls and very few seeds. The flavor is rich, sweet, and concentrated with low moisture, making it ideal for fresh use, roasting, and especially for sauces and preservation. Does great for gardeners with small gardens or grown in containers.
